The College Area Community Council (CACC) is the local community
council for the
College Area. The acts as a town forum for neighborhood
issues, community organizations, and regular interaction
directly with elected officials, city departments, Police, San
Diego State University (SDSU) and other community stakeholders.
The CACC is an all-volunteer community group and welcomes
community members to attend meetings, receive the newsletters,
serve on the board and committees, and provide feedback to the
board.
The College Area Community Planning Board (CACPB)
is the City of San Diego designated Planning Group for the College Area.
The CACPB is an all-volunteer advisory board that makes
recommendations to the San Diego Planning Commission and the San
Diego City Council. The CACPB
meets concurrently with the CACC.
The CACPB is
one of only two city-designated Planning Groups in the College Neighborhoods. |

Committees
The CACC has several committees which also meet each month to
discuss the main agenda items and topics of concern in the
College Area. The committees review each topic in great
detail and allows more opportunity for community input than the
full CACPB/CACC is able to afford because of time constraints.
Many community members attend specific committee meetings to
learn more detail about specific topics or projects which
interest them. To learn more about the CACPB/CACC committees,
